About This Home

Available Now

Charming 4-bedroom,2½-bath Colonial in a desirable central Oakhurst location! This clean and inviting home offers a spacious layout,traditional Colonial charm,and a kitchen that opens to a lovely deckperfect for outdoor dining,relaxing,and entertaining. Four nice sized bedrooms provide plenty of living space,while the unfinished basement offers convenient storage and includes a washer and dryer. Ample street parking. Ideally located near shopping,dining,transportation,parks,and more. A wonderful opportunity to enjoy all that Oakhurst has to offer! MLS ID 22628329

215 Elberon Blvd is a house located in Monmouth County and the 07755 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Township Of Ocean School District attendance zone.

Neighborhood

Long Branch City is the coastal area of Long Branch. Residents of this section of town can enjoy relaxed beach life while only being 55 miles south of New York City. Within Long Branch City, residents can walk along Long Branch Boardwalk to view scenic beaches and journey to the many oceanfront restaurants. For shopping, residents will have to travel a bit out of town to Highway 35 to find premier shopping destinations like Monmouth Mall, Shrewsbury Plaza, and many more.

The rental scene in Long Branch City is made up of houses, apartments, and condos in a range of prices. Whether you’re a renter looking for a luxury apartment, a quiet condo overlooking the ocean, or a Colonial-style house situated near a main road, Long Branch City has a spot for everyone.
